What is the average salary of DeVry University Adjunct Instructor?

DeVry University Adjunct Instructors earn $52,000 annually, or $25 per hour, which is equal to the national average for all Adjunct Instructors at $52,000 annually and 24% lower than the national salary average for ​all working Americans. The highest paid Adjunct Instructors work for Northwood University at $147,000 annually and the lowest paid Adjunct Instructors work for Bryan College at $15,000 annually.
